Whiskey on the Green

Image

There’s something special about the wild open spaces of a golf course. It provides an escape from the inner city hustle, a place to unwind and relax.

So when Glenmorangie Whiskey asked Katering to design a beautiful menu for a twilight dinner on the green of Bonnie Doon golf course, it was our pleasure to put together a night of appreciation and elegance.

Image

The specially crafted three-course menu was paired with hand picked whiskeys and showcased hints of citrus and ginger throughout.

Image

First course featured a trio of citrus seafood including lime and ginger crab dumplings, seared scallops and citrus tempura yabbie with ginger chutney.

Image

As the sun began to set, guests were served an orange pepper venison with parsnip puree, baby fennel and onion jus.

Image

For something sweet, a ginger crème brulee tart completed the evening.

Image

As guests settled in with delicious food and Glenmorangie whiskeys, it was only the sprinklers that would tear them away from a beautiful night under the stars.

A Special Spring Christening

At one of our favourite Sydney locations, the lovely Nubia from Katering celebrated the christening of her son Romeo.

Image

Set amongst beautiful Callan Park in Balmain, Nubia picked some of her favourite Katering bites for a day of celebration and feasting with family and friends.

Image

Upon arrival at the historic Callan Park grounds, guests were offered canapés including garlic prawns with chorizo, smoked salmon on dill blini with horseradish, crème fraiche and salmon roe, steamed Peking duck crepes, mini Yorkshire puddings with caramelised onions and rare roasted beef fillet and shiitake mushroom dumplings with chilli jam.

Image

Snapper fillets with wedges of kumera potato provided something more substantial as family and friends mingled and the Katering chefs tended to the lamb on the spit. Basted with rosemary, lemon and garlic oil the lamb was served with crunchy potatoes and avocado salad.

The Katering pastry chef created a beautiful croquembouche held together with sweet, delicate toffee that was filled with vanilla bean custard. Mini-desserts of vanilla bean panacotta, pavlova, crème caramels, rocky road and chocolate coated strawberries added the final sweet touch.

Image

 

Image

As the afternoon sun began to set, family and friends danced to beautiful Latin music as a hot Sydney spring day came to an end.

Belle Artist’s Dinner

Katering recently had the pleasure of creating a special menu for the Belle Artist’s Dinner at Dinosaur Designs in Sydney. The evening was a celebration of fine food, wine, art and design and was sponsored by Petaluma wines.

Image

Michael Reid took the stage and interviewed Louise Olsen and Stephen Ormandy from Dinosaur Designs. They spoke passionately about their empire, what’s in a design and what it is that inspires them. Whether it be something as simple as a word, their designs stem take something small and tell a beautiful story.

Image

Guests were entertained with an intricately crafted three-course menu, here’s a sneak peek at what we served on the night.

Canapes served with Petaluma Croser NV

  • Mud crab and pomelo salad
  • Oyster panna cotta en croute
  • Three cheese wonton with salsa verde
  • Broad bean, feta and mint bruschetta

Image

Image

Entrée served with Petaluma Sauvignon Blanc

Entrees were designed to share and presented on Dinosaur Designs platters

  • Yamba prawns with chilli, mint, lemon and garlic
  • Veal and pork meatballs served with tomato coulis and basil
  • Salad of crumbed artichokes, goat’s curd, broad bean and cabernet dressing

Image

Image

Image

Main served with 2011 Petaluma White Chardonnay or 2010 Petaluma White Cabernet Sauvignon

  • Poached salmon with watercress, apple and pickled ginger salad with champagne vinaigrette

Image

Image

Image

Image

Salads and sides

  • Red salad with pomegranate, radicchio, blood orange and beetroot with beetroot leaves and ricotta
  • Haloumi, asparagus, broad bean and fennel salad with mint and lemon dressing
  • Crunchy rosemary potatoes

Dessert

  • Panna cotta with fresh berries, coulis and crisp tuille
